What is a CS: GO Crash Game?

At its core, a Crash game is a variation of a multiplier-based betting game. The idea is simple yet agonizingly tense: a multiplier begins at 1.00 x and continuously increases. The goal of the gamer is to "cash out" before the multiplier randomly "crashes."

If cs2skin.com a player cashes out in time, they win their initial bet multiplied by the current figure. If the video game crashes before they cash out, they lose their entire stake.

While the game was originally promoted in cryptocurrency circles, its combination with CS: GO skin economies-- where virtual weapon finishes act as currency-- produced a massive subculture within the gaming neighborhood.

How the Game Works: Step-by-Step

Playing a CS: GO Crash game generally takes just a couple of seconds per round. Here is the requirement flow of a game session:

  • Deposit Skins or Funds: Players log into a third-party CS: GO betting website utilizing their Steam account and deposit weapon skins, crypto, or fiat currency. Skins are normally transformed into site credits.
  • Location a Bet: Before the round starts, the gamer picks just how much they wish to bet. Many websites also enable players to set an "Auto-Cashout" limit.
  • The Round Begins: A rocket, jet, or line begins to ascend on a graph, and the multiplier ticks upward (e.g., 1.05 x, 1.20 x, 2.50 x, 10.00 x).
  • The Cashout: The player strikes the "Cash Out" button before the crash happens.
  • The Crash: The multiplier stops arbitrarily. Some rounds crash quickly at 1.00 x (leaving players no time to respond), while others reach 100x, 500x, or greater.

Popular Strategies for CS: GO Crash

Due to the fact that Crash is a video game of opportunity governed by a Random Number Generator (RNG)-- often protected by Provably Fair algorithms-- there is no surefire method to win. However, players over the years have adopted several betting systems to manage their bankroll and take full advantage of entertainment.

1. The Martingale Strategy

  • How it works: After every loss, the gamer doubles their bet. When they eventually win, the profit covers all previous losses plus a profit equivalent to the original base bet.
  • The Risk: Requires an enormous bankroll. Striking a long losing streak can rapidly tire a player's funds or hit site betting limitations.

2. The Anti-Martingale (Paroli) Strategy

  • How it works: The player doubles their bet after every win and resets to the base bet after a loss. This aims to profit from winning streaks while lessening direct exposure during cold streaks.
  • The Risk: A single late loss erases the built up profits of the streak.

3. Low Auto-Cashout Grinding

  • How it works: Players set an automated cashout at an extremely low multiplier, such as 1.10 x to 1.20 x, and place bigger bets.
  • The Risk: While winning percentage is high, an instantaneous 1.00 x crash will wipe out multiple wins in a single blow.

Key Features of CS: GO Crash Sites

Modern CS: GO betting platforms offer more than just an increasing multiplier. Users can normally access a suite of features created to boost the experience:

  • Provably Fair Systems: Cryptographic algorithms that permit gamers to verify that the result of every round was predetermined and not controlled by the home.
  • Live Chat: A neighborhood chatbox where gamers can celebrate massive multipliers, commiserate over instantaneous crashes, or interact with other users.
  • Rain/Tips: Community includes where rich gamers or the website itself occasionally disperse complimentary credits to active chat members.
  • Leaderboards: Daily, weekly, or month-to-month competitions rewarding the highest multipliers or total wagered amounts with bonus offer skins.

Risks and Safety Precautions

Engaging with CS: GO Crash games involves genuine monetary danger, mostly due to the fact that virtual skins hold real-world monetary value. Before taking part, players need to keep numerous safety standards in mind:

  • Understand the House Edge: Like all casino-style video games, Crash is mathematically developed to favor your house over the long term.
  • Beware of Scams and Phishing: The CS: GO gambling community draws in malicious actors. Always ensure you are using genuine, well-known domains and never log into unproven third-party sites using your main Steam credentials unless you rely on the platform's security.
  • Set Strict Limits: Decide on a rigorous spending plan before playing and never chase losses. Deal with skin betting as a type of home entertainment with an associated expense, instead of a reliable method to earn money.
  • Inspect Local Laws: Online gambling laws vary significantly by country and area. Make sure that taking part in skin-based gambling is legal in your jurisdiction.
